API 5+:
For apps targeting API level 5+ there is the Activities overridePendingTransition method. It takes two resource IDs for the incoming and outgoing animations. An id of 0 will disable the animations. Call this immediately after the...

With ng-bind-html-unsafe removed, how do I inject HTML?
...ION]/angular-sanitize.min.js
you need to include ngSanitize module on your app
eg: var app = angular.module('myApp', ['ngSanitize']);
you just need to bind with ng-bind-html the original html content. No need to do anything else in your controller. The parsing and conversion is automatically done by...
